This article presents a close examination of representations of educational testing in dystopian young adult fiction published between 2004 and 2014. Analysis focuses on understanding how testing and its repercussions are represented in these novels, and what such might say about the contemporary cultural value placed on testing. At the same time, given that testing is a prominent feature of dystopias, we also explore what the conflation of testing with dystopic political structures might be saying critically about high-stakes testing.
